Jose’s Time in Washington
It’s been two great seasons in Washington for Jose Theodore, who told The Washington Post that he won’t be returning to the Capitals this coming season shortly after winning the Bill Masterton Memorial Trophy on Wednesday in Las Vegas.
Theodore had a good run in Washington during the past two regular seasons, but with Semyon Varlamov and Michal Neuvirth playing behind him, if not in before him, and the team in need of some cap space, the move doesn’t come as a surprise.
Here’s how Theodore performed as a Cap.
Year | GP | MIN | W | L | T | OTL | EGA | GA | GAA | SA | SV | SV% | SO | ||
2008-09 | 57 | 3287 | 32 | 17 | 0 | 5 | 4 | 157 | 2.87 | 1572 | 1415 | .900 | 2 | ||
2009-10 | 47 | 2586 | 30 | 7 | 0 | 7 | 1 | 121 | 2.81 | 1352 | 1231 | .911 | 1 | ||
Career Totals | 548 | 30998 | 245 | 220 | 30 | 22 | 45 | 1387 | 2.68 | 15127 | 13740 | .908 | 29 |
